Default jdm gs-r idle/stalling problems

Ok well here's the deal, I have a 98 ek w/ a stock obd2 b18c... Im running a jumper harness into an obd1 chipped p72, also it's not throwing any codes right now... My problem is that my idle fluctuates between 1500 to 2000 rpm when warmed up... I cleaned out the IACV and FITV... checked for any vacuum leaks and there are none... and still the problem is there... Also at time when im cruising my car would occasionally die on me and it'll take me approx 10mins to start it back up... I ran out of ideas on what to do... I was wondering if you all can help me out with my situation, any suggestions would help... my last resort is to take it to a shop...

Have you checked the throttle cable or the idle adjustment screw? I had that problem on my EJ1 and I messed around with the idle adjustment screw and it fixed it.
